What are 3 examples of productivity software?

Productivity software is an application that enables the creation of various types of documents, presentations, and worksheets. It is commonly used in businesses and offices, and includes tools like database management systems (DBMS), word processors, spreadsheet applications, and graphics software. These tools assist in completing assigned tasks, enhancing communication and collaboration. Initially designed for business use, productivity software has evolved to include personal use, and most are now available on tablets and smartphones. When choosing productivity software, it is crucial to ensure its reliability, as it is used to store and share critical business data.

Can I use a gaming laptop for productivity?

Gaming laptops can be used for work due to their high-performance graphics cards and spacious screens, making them ideal for handling complex software and web pages with lots of graphics. These laptops are particularly suitable for creative fields like design, illustration, or creative designing. The main advantage of gaming laptops for work is their durable hardware components, including a high-performing CPU and graphics card. The combination of these components can significantly improve the efficiency of tasks like video editing and high-definition media consumption.

A powerful CPU can enhance the performance of various tasks, from web browsing to document management, maximizing speed to the greatest extent possible. Despite their high cost, gaming laptops can be a suitable alternative for those in creative fields like design, illustration, or creative designing.

Is a laptop better than a PC for productivity?

Programming can be done on both laptops and desktop PCs, depending on individual needs and preferences. Desktop PCs are more powerful and easier to upgrade, making them suitable for complex tasks. Laptops, on the other hand, allow for remote work and collaboration in various environments. Performance varies depending on the specific model and components, but desktop PCs are generally more powerful due to their larger size and better cooling, making them suitable for more intensive tasks like gaming or video editing.

When choosing between a laptop and a desktop PC, consider factors such as budget, work type, portability, and desired customization and upgradability. Overall, both laptops and desktop PCs offer various benefits for programming.

What is considered productivity work?

Productivity in the workplace is the amount of work done over a specific period, measured by customer acquisition, phone calls, and sales. It is a performance measure that compares the output of a product with the input resources required to produce it, such as labor, equipment, or money. In the business world, productivity measures the efficiency of a company’s production process, measured by the number of units produced relative to labor hours or net sales relative to labor hours. Corporate profits and shareholder returns are directly linked to productivity growth, highlighting the importance of understanding and utilizing productivity in various sectors.

What is the difference between gaming laptop and productivity laptop?

The cost of a laptop depends on its specifications, brand, and intended use. Gaming laptops have high-end graphics cards and processors, making them more expensive. Business laptops are designed for productivity and focus on durability, security, portability, and battery life. Budget-friendly options are preferred by this audience. When choosing the best laptop for gaming and work, consider factors such as a powerful CPU (like Intel Core i7 or AMD Ryzen 7), sufficient RAM (16GB or more), and a dedicated graphics card (NVIDIA GeForce or AMD Radeon).

This combination ensures smooth gaming experiences and efficient multitasking for work-related applications. Many people opt for the best mobile workstations as work-and-play laptops due to their high-performance capabilities. By considering these factors, you can find the perfect laptop for gaming and work that strikes the perfect balance between these two aspects.

  • windows os uses GiB, MiB and TiB instead of GB, MB abnd TB. That’s why 2 TB shows 1.83 TiB, But Windows refreshed their naming scheme so TiB shows as TB. GiB is Gibibyte not Gigabyte and GB is gigabyte – GiB follows binary system so 1 GiB = 1024 MiB = 1024 x 1024 KiB = 1024 x 1024 x 1024 byte = 1,073,741,824 byte whereas GB is Gigabyte and it follows decimal system so 1 GB = 1000 MB = 1000 x 1000 KB = 1000 x 1000 x 1000 byte = 1,000,000,000 byte so GiB is bigger than GB and TiB is bigger than TB

  • That is not what a MUX switch does. Using MUX we can run the laptop display directly from dedicated gpu. Without MUX switch the laptop display is always run by processor gpu. Without MUX switch only external display is run by dedicated GPU. With MUX switch we can have laptop display to run on dedicated GPU which is not possible without the MUX switch.

  • There are two notions of measuring Storage spaces:- 1) The computer way of measuring i.e binary way which we all must have read in schools computer books like KiB, MiB, GiB, TiB, etc. So, in this notion 2 Tib = 2048 Gib 2) The metric system of measuring like KB, MB, GB, TB, etc. In this notion 2 TB = 2000 GB Now internationally and by rule of iupac the Metric system of 1 TB = 1000 GB notion is accepted. Many storage device manufacturers accepted this a long time ago but for some reason Microsoft uses the Binary notion of 1 TiB = 1024 GiB. Further they don’t even use the correct symbol like in the binary notion it’s called 1 TiB but Microsoft uses the binary notion and uses the Metric symbol of 1 TB. This difference in the notion of calculation between the storage manufacturers and windows creates a 7% difference in size shown in windows. And then there are some hidden partitions which windows have like an Efi of around 100mb, a fairly small MSR, and a Recovery partition of around 800mb

  • The reason your laptop shows 1.83 TB of storage instead of 2 TB is due to the way storage capacity is calculated. Manufacturers typically advertise storage in decimal (base 10), where 1 TB is 1,000,000,000,000 bytes. However, computers calculate storage in binary (base 2), where 1 TB is 1,099,511,627,776 bytes. As a result, when the system translates the advertised 2 TB in decimal to binary, it shows a slightly smaller capacity—around 1.83 TB in this case. This is normal and expected for most storage devices.
